Research Project:
BIOLOGICAL CONTROL OF LYGODIUM
Location: IPRL, Fort Lauderdale, Florida
2007 Annual Report
1a.Objectives (from AD-416)
Discover and develop biological control agents for lygodium. Determine potential host range and environmental safety of promising agents.
1b.Approach (from AD-416)
Survey of natural enemies in the plant's native range of Asia and Australia. Determine life histories of agents and conduct host specificity tests. Petition of release, attempt and evaluate colonization and impact of approved agents.
